## The Majestic Beauty of Yellowstone National Park
Nestled across Wyoming, Montana, and Idaho, Yellowstone is America’s first national park and a beacon of natural wonders. Known for its geothermal features, including the famous Old Faithful geyser, Yellowstone boasts breathtaking landscapes, from the dramatic canyons of the Yellowstone River to expansive meadows teeming with wildlife.
• Key Highlights:
– Visit the Grand Canyon of the Yellowstone for stunning views of waterfalls.
– Explore the thermal wonders of the Upper Geyser Basin.
– Spot bison, elk, and even the elusive wolf in their natural habitat.

## The Grand Splendor of Yosemite National Park
Located in California’s Sierra Nevada mountains, Yosemite National Park is renowned for its granite cliffs, cascading waterfalls, and giant sequoias. The iconic El Capitan and Half Dome provide some of the most spectacular views in the world.
• Must-See Attractions:
– Hike to Glacier Point for a panoramic view of the valley.
– Marvel at the beauty of Yosemite Falls, one of the tallest in North America.
– Don’t miss out on sighting the giant sequoias at Mariposa Grove.

## The Serene Landscapes of Zion National Park
In southern Utah, Zion National Park offers a different flavor of scenery with its stunning red rock formations, lush canyons, and towering cliffs. Known for its impressive canyon views, Zion is a haven for both hikers and photographers.
• Tips for Visitors:
– Take the scenic drive through the park to appreciate the breathtaking vistas.
– Hike the famous Angels Landing for a challenging trek with stunning rewards.
– Explore the Virgin River’s picturesque surroundings for a more peaceful experience.

## The Untouched Paradise of Glacier National Park
Home to over 700 miles of hiking trails, Glacier National Park in Montana is a dream destination for outdoor lovers. The park’s rugged mountains and pristine lakes offer unparalleled nature views that change with the seasons.
• Things to Do:
– Drive the Going-to-the-Sun Road for incredible views of the landscape.
– Hike to Grinnell Glacier for one of the park’s most breathtaking spots.
– Watch for wildlife, including bear, moose, and mountain goats along the trails.

## The Timeless Charm of Acadia National Park
While often overshadowed by larger parks, Acadia National Park in Maine boasts some of the most picturesque coastlines in America. With rocky shores and beautiful forested areas, Acadia is particularly stunning during the fall.
• Visitor Highlights:
– Drive up Cadillac Mountain for the first sunrise in the U.S. each day.
– Explore the scenic Park Loop Road for multiple overlooks.
– Enjoy some of the best coastal views while hiking along the Ocean Path.

1. Big Sur, California, USA
Big Sur is often lauded for its majestic cliffs that tumble into the Pacific Ocean, creating a surreal backdrop for nature lovers and photographers alike. The iconic Highway 1 winds through this region, offering numerous viewpoints where visitors can take in the expansive views of the ocean framed by towering redwoods. Key spots to stop include:
• McWay Falls: A stunning waterfall that drops directly onto the beach, especially mesmerizing at sunset.
• Pfeiffer Beach: Known for its purple sand and sea stacks, it is a great place to capture iconic images against the backdrop of the Pacific.

####
2. Amalfi Coast, Italy
The Amalfi Coast is synonymous with picturesque coastal views and charming cliffside villages. This UNESCO World Heritage Site captivates travelers with its colorful houses perched atop steep cliffs, crystal-clear waters, and lush landscapes. Highlights include:
• Positano: Famous for its steep, winding streets and stunning beach views.
• Ravello: Offers breathtaking panoramic views and lush gardens, perfect for a peaceful retreat.

####
3. Great Ocean Road, Australia
Stretching over 240 kilometers along Victoria’s coast, the Great Ocean Road is a route that combines stunning coastal views with cultural landmarks. Notable natural wonders include:
• Twelve Apostles: Impressive limestone stacks rising dramatically from the Southern Ocean.
• Loch Ard Gorge: A site of significant historical interest where you can enjoy rugged coastal beauty.

####
4. Santorini, Greece
Santorini is world-renowned for its stunning sunsets and white-washed buildings perched on cliffs above the Aegean Sea. This volcanic island features:
• Oia Village: Famous for its panoramic views of the caldera, particularly at sunset.
• Red Beach: Known for its unique red-hued cliffs and crystal-clear waters, ideal for sunbathing and swimming.

1. The Majestic Swiss Alps

The Swiss Alps are iconic for a reason. With towering peaks like the Matterhorn and the Eiger, this region boasts a rich tapestry of breathtaking landscapes. Visitors can hike the Five Lakes Walk in Zermatt, where you can witness shimmering alpine lakes reflecting the grandeur of surrounding peaks. Skiing in winter is world-renowned, particularly in areas like Verbier and St. Moritz, providing stunning sight after stunning sight.

###
2. The Rocky Mountains, USA

Spanning multiple states including Colorado, Wyoming, and Montana, the Rocky Mountains offer some of the best nature views in the United States. Explore Rocky Mountain National Park for its dramatic peaks, wildflower-filled meadows, and wildlife. For an unforgettable experience, drive the Trail Ridge Road, one of the highest paved roads in North America, or hike to Bear Lake for remarkable views of the surrounding mountains.

###
3. Torres del Paine, Chile

Nestled in Patagonia, Torres del Paine National Park is a dream destination for nature lovers. Its granite peaks, deep valleys, and stunning glaciers create a dramatic backdrop for hiking and photography. The famous W Trek allows you to see the renowned Torres del Paine towers up close, offering picturesque landscapes that shift with the light throughout the day, providing countless opportunities for unforgettable photos.

###
4. The Dolomites, Italy

Rec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age site, the Dolomites in northern Italy offer some of the most striking mountain scenery in the world. Characterized by unique rock formations and colorful sunsets, the area is perfect for hiking, skiing, and climbing. Take in breathtaking views while hiking the Alta Via 1 or enjoy the tranquility of Lago di Braies, one of the most photogenic lakes amidst the mountains.

###
5. The Canadian Rockies, Canada

Home to stunning national parks like Banff and Jasper, the Canadian Rockies are a treasure trove of natural beauty. Visitors can revel in rich turquoise lakes, pristine forests, and soaring peaks. Don’t miss the opportunity to ride the Banff Gondola for panoramic views or explore Maligne Lake in Jasper, where you can take a boat tour to view the stunning Spirit Island while surrounded by dramatic mountains.

5. Exotic Rainforests and Wildlife Sanctuaries
When it comes to breathtaking nature views, few destinations can rival the awe-inspiring beauty of exotic rainforests and wildlife sanctuaries. These verdant landscapes not only provide stunning visuals but also serve as critical habitats for diverse flora and fauna. Here are some top destinations around the globe that promise an immersive experience into nature’s heart:

• Amazon Rainforest, South America: Spanning multiple countries, the Amazon is the world’s largest rainforest and teems with wildlife, including jaguars, sloths, and countless bird species. Consider taking a guided tour from Manaus, Brazil, where you can explore the rainforest’s depths by foot, kayak, or boat.

• Borneo, Malaysia: Known for its ancient rainforests, Borneo offers rich biodiversity, including the critically endangered orangutan. Visit the Sepilok Orangutan Rehabilitation Centre in Sabah, where you can witness conservation efforts firsthand and enjoy guided treks through lush greenery.

• Costa Rica: With more than 25% of its land protected, Costa Rica is a paradise for nature lovers. The Monteverde Cloud Forest Reserve is famous for its misty, mysterious beauty and high canopy walkways. Don’t miss the chance to spot unique wildlife like the resplendent quetzal.

• Daintree Rainforest, Australia: This World Heritage-listed site is one of the oldest rainforests on Earth. Home to an array of unique species, visitors can explore its trails and rivers, learning about Aboriginal culture while observing its extraordinary wildlife.

• Great Smoky Mountains National Park, USA: If you seek varied landscapes and a rich tapestry of life, the Great Smoky Mountains should be on your list. Offering stunning vistas, diverse ecosystems, and rich cultural history, it is the most visited national park in the United States, perfect for hiking and exploring.
